What Is Instantly.ai?
Instantly.ai is a cold email outreach platform that started as a simple cold email sequencer.
Today, it’s grown into a modular suite with five distinct products sharing one dashboard.

Those five modules are:
- Email Outreach: Campaign builder, multi-inbox sending, AI sequences
- Lead Finder (Instantly Credits): B2B contact database with 450M+ contacts
- CRM: Pipeline management and lead tracking
- Inbox Placement: Deliverability testing and monitoring
- Website Visitors: Identify companies visiting your site and route them into campaigns
The platform is built for agencies, solo operators, and SDR teams running cold email at scale.
It’s one of the most-reviewed cold email tools on G2, with consistent praise for ease of setup and multi-inbox management.

What Real Users Say About Instantly (G2, Trustpilot, Reddit)
Before I share what I found, here’s what thousands of actual users are saying.
This section pulls from G2, Trustpilot, and Reddit to give you the full picture, not just the highlight reel.
G2: 4.8/5 from 3,400+ Reviews
G2 users are largely happy. The praise follows a clear pattern:
- Setup speed: Users consistently call Instantly one of the fastest cold email tools to get running, even without technical experience
- Multi-inbox management: Agency owners highlight splitting campaign volume across 10+ inboxes from one dashboard without per-seat cost
- Warm-up convenience: New senders appreciate the automatic warm-up that runs in the background without separate tool configuration
- Unibox: Managing replies from multiple domains in a single inbox gets consistent praise from high-volume users
- Template library: 1,000+ templates across agency, SaaS, hiring, and partnership use cases
The downsides G2 users mention are more subtle. Pricing complexity as you add modules comes up often.
Integration depth for enterprise stacks feels limited. AI-generated copy quality is inconsistent without prompt iteration.
One thing to keep in mind. G2 reviews skew toward satisfied users who actively chose to leave a review.
The Trustpilot distribution paints a different picture.
Trustpilot: 3.8/5 from 987 Reviews
This is where things get more honest. Trustpilot captures the users who had problems, and the patterns are specific.
Credits system change (2025): Long-term users found the switch from subscription-based contacts to a credits model confusing.
Multiple reviews flag billing glitches where credits were deducted incorrectly.
DFY domain ownership problem: This one is serious. Several Trustpilot reviews from January 2026 flag that domains set up through Instantly’s Done-For-You service are retained by Instantly.
If you try to use those domains with another tool or leave the platform, you hit resistance. One agency owner described support becoming unresponsive after raising this issue.
Support quality at scale: Fast for simple technical questions. But multiple agency owners managing large client lists report support slows down or goes quiet as account complexity grows.
Deliverability black box: When warm-up or inbox placement breaks, there’s no diagnostic path. No alerts, no root cause data, nothing to act on.
There’s a noticeable spike in critical reviews from January and February 2026.
The complaints cluster around DFY setup and support quality. This is a recent pattern, not a long-standing one.
I reviewed these 987 Trustpilot reviews directly in March 2026.
Reddit: The Unfiltered Version
Reddit is where the filter comes off. The cold email community on r/coldemail and r/Emailmarketing doesn’t hold back.
The patterns I found:
- Warm-up scores can be misleading: Multiple threads report inboxes showing “healthy” inside Instantly’s dashboard while campaigns still land in spam. The warm-up pool engagement isn’t translating to real inbox placement in some cases.
- DFY accounts getting flagged: Separate from the domain ownership issue. Actual deliverability problems appear more frequently on DFY-configured accounts than self-configured ones.
- Campaigns stopping without warning: Several threads reference sequences halting mid-campaign with no error notification.
But there’s a positive side too. One agency owner on r/coldemail sent 2,500 emails in a single campaign, landed four clients, and called the warm-up “super reliable.”
The Reddit divide reflects two real user profiles. Instantly works reliably when you do your own DNS setup, run clean lists, and stay within reasonable send volumes.
Problems surface when you scale fast, use DFY infrastructure, or rely on the platform to manage deliverability for you.
Instantly.ai Features: What I Found After Testing
Now that you know what users are saying, here’s what I found when I actually tested each module. I’ll call out where my experience matched the reviews and where it didn’t.
Cold Email Outreach
This is Instantly’s core. And it’s genuinely well built.
The campaign builder is clean and intuitive. You get drag-and-drop sequences, scheduling controls, and conditional subsequences that trigger different follow-up paths based on whether a prospect opened but didn’t reply.
The standout feature is multi-inbox sending. You can split a 2,000-email campaign across 10+ connected inboxes.
This keeps you under per-account daily sending limits without hitting Gmail or Outlook caps.
All paid plans include unlimited email account connections. No per-inbox cost. No per-seat friction. That’s rare in this space.
Other features worth noting:
- A/Z testing (Hyper Growth and above): Test up to 26 subject line or body copy variants in a single campaign
- AI Sequence Generator: Creates full multi-step sequences from a brief. Useful for drafts, but quality varies. Expect to iterate on prompts before the output is usable.
- Unibox (Hyper Growth+): Centralizes replies from all connected accounts into one inbox with filtering and tagging. Genuinely useful when you’re managing 20+ active inboxes.
- Template library: 1,000+ templates across agency, SaaS, hiring, and partnership categories. Good starting point, but you’ll need customization for any real personalization.
- Integrations: HubSpot, Salesforce, Zapier, and API access
- Supported providers: Gmail, Outlook, and custom SMTP
The AI-generated copy quality issue that G2 users flag is real. I tested the sequence generator with three different briefs. One produced a usable draft.
The other two needed significant rewriting. It’s a time-saver for structure, not a replacement for good copywriting.
Email Warm-Up
Warm-up activates automatically when you connect an inbox. No manual configuration needed for the default setup.
For most users, this convenience is a genuine advantage.
Advanced settings are available:
- Read emulation that simulates a human scrolling through warm-up emails
- Configurable reply rates and daily volume ramp
- Weekday-only sending option
Instantly’s own documentation recommends warming for 20 to 30 days before your first campaign.
They also recommend keeping warm-up running continuously alongside live campaigns.
Now here’s where the Reddit feedback lines up with my testing.
The warm-up dashboard reflects activity within Instantly’s pool. It does not reflect actual inbox placement performance.
These are not the same thing.
Your dashboard can show a healthy warm-up score while your real campaigns land in spam.
This is the core limitation:
- No diagnostic visibility: When deliverability degrades, there are no alerts, no root-cause analysis, and no tooling to identify the issue
- Closed signal loop: The “health” score is based on interactions within Instantly’s own network, not on how Gmail or Outlook actually perceive your domain
- Outlook-specific issues: Multiple users flag inconsistent deliverability specifically with Outlook inboxes. Outlook’s filtering is stricter for new senders, and seed-network warm-up may not generate the right signals for Outlook’s trust model.
The problems surface at scale or when you rely on it as your only deliverability safeguard.
Lead Finder (Instantly Credits)
The Lead Finder is sold as a separate subscription under “Instantly Credits” inside the app.
It’s not included in the base Email Outreach plan.
The database claims 450M+ B2B contacts.
You can filter by job title, company size, revenue, industry, tech stack, location, and more across 13 filter types.
The AI natural language search is a nice touch.
Type a query like “Sales managers at Series B SaaS companies in the US” and it generates filtered results. Useful for quick prospecting without building manual filters.
Instantly also runs waterfall email enrichment with 5+ providers.
This sequences through multiple data sources to improve email match accuracy before you export contacts.
Here’s the honest take on data quality. G2 and Reddit both flag the same issue consistently:
- Outdated email addresses
- Wrong job titles
- Elevated bounce rates from raw database exports
If lead data accuracy is central to your workflow, a dedicated provider like Apollo, ZoomInfo, or Cognism is still likely needed alongside Instantly’s database.
Best use case? Testing new segments quickly. Or when you need “good enough” data fast without building a separate data stack.
It’s not a replacement for a primary data provider, but it’s a useful supplement.
I tested the filter system and AI search bar inside the app. The UI is straightforward.
One thing I noticed: the in-app pricing shown at time of testing didn’t perfectly match the public pricing page. Worth double-checking before purchase.
CRM
Instantly’s CRM exists. But let’s set expectations correctly.
Two tiers are available:
- Growth CRM ($47/mo annual): Unlimited seats, master inbox, detailed lead view, advanced opportunities, tasks and follow-ups, reporting, leads/campaigns/lists management, integrations
- Hyper CRM ($97/mo annual): Everything in Growth plus calling and SMS, website visitors inside CRM, Instantly AI, Salesflows, and advanced team reporting. Priority AI and Follow-up AI are listed as “coming soon” as of March 2026.
This is not a HubSpot or Pipedrive replacement. Pipeline views are basic. Automation is lightweight. Deal management lacks depth.
Best use case: you’re currently using no CRM and want outreach plus basic pipeline tracking in one dashboard. The Growth CRM tier covers most small team needs.
If you’re already on HubSpot or Salesforce, native integrations are available. That makes the Instantly CRM redundant for most established teams. Don’t pay for it unless you genuinely need a CRM from scratch.
Inbox Placement Testing
This is Instantly’s deliverability testing module. It tells you where your emails land across major providers.
Two tiers:
- Growth Inbox Placement ($47/mo annual): Unlimited one-time deliverability tests, unlimited sending accounts per test, domain/IP/account health monitoring, SPF/DMARC/DKIM checks, blacklist monitoring, ESP and deliverability insights. Plan is shareable across all workspaces.
- Hypergrowth Inbox Placement ($97/mo annual): Everything in Growth plus unlimited automated recurring tests and advanced deliverability triggers and actions.
What a test shows: where your email lands (Primary, Promotions, Updates, or Spam) across major email service providers. It includes AI-suggested fixes for identified issues.
Who should pay for this: Agencies managing multiple client domains and teams running campaigns across 10+ inboxes. The automated recurring tests at the Hypergrowth tier flag issues before they cost you a campaign.
Who can skip it: Solo operators running a handful of domains. Free tools like MXToolbox, Mail Tester, or GlockApps’ free tier cover basic checks. The paid module adds real value at scale, not for one-person operations.
I navigated to the Inbox Placement tab inside the app and verified the two-tier structure in March 2026.
Website Visitor Identification
This is Instantly’s newest and most differentiated feature. No other cold email platform bundles website visitor identification natively at this price point.
Here’s what it does. It identifies companies (and in some cases individuals) visiting your website. It resolves them to email and/or LinkedIn. Then it can automatically add them to an Instantly campaign or contact list.
Three tiers:
- Hyper Visitors ($97/mo annual): 500 credits, company-only resolutions, phone resolutions, auto-add to campaign or list
- Lightspeed Visitors ($397/mo annual): 5,000 credits, same features
- Enterprise: Custom pricing, contact support
Tools like Warmly or Albacross do website visitor identification as standalone products at higher price points. They don’t offer the native campaign integration that Instantly does.
Reality check: at $97/mo for 500 credits, the per-resolution cost is high if you have significant traffic.
The value is in the native integration. A warm website visitor dropped directly into an outreach sequence without any Zapier glue.
Best use case: SDR teams and agencies who want to capture intent signals from their own website and act on them immediately within their existing Instantly campaigns.
I navigated to the Website Visitors tab and verified the three-tier structure from inside the app in March 2026.

Instantly.ai Pricing: The Real Cost When You Stack Everything
This is the section most Instantly reviews get wrong. They show you one pricing table and call it a day. Instantly has five separate billing lines. The stacked cost is what catches people off guard.
All prices below are annual billing, verified from inside the Instantly app and the public pricing page in March 2026.
Email Outreach Plans
| Plan | Monthly Cost (Annual) | Emails/Month | Uploaded Contacts | Key Features |
| Growth | $47/mo | 5,000 | 1,000 | Unlimited email accounts, warm-up, automated sequences |
| Hyper Growth | $97/mo | 125,000 | 25,000 | A/Z testing, Unibox, priority support, global block list |
| Light Speed | $358/mo | 500,000 | 100,000 | Server and IP sharding, rotation system |
Free trial available: 250 uploaded contacts, no credit card required.
All paid plans include unlimited email account connections.
Instantly Credits Plans (Lead Finder / SuperSearch)
| Plan | Monthly Cost (Annual) | Credits/Month | Key Features |
| Nano | $9/mo | 150 | 450M+ B2B database, 13 filters, AI email writer, waterfall enrichment |
| Growth | $42.30/mo | 1,500 to 2,000 | Everything in Nano |
| Supersonic | $87.30/mo | 5,000 to 7,500 | Everything in Nano |
| Hyper Credits | $177.30/mo | 10,000 to 200,000 | Everything in Nano |
Note: In-app pricing showed $47/mo for Growth on the monthly toggle when I tested. Verify the monthly vs. annual discrepancy before purchasing. Last verified: March 2026.
CRM Plans
| Plan | Monthly Cost (Annual) | Key Features |
| Growth CRM | $47/mo | Unlimited seats, master inbox, lead management, tasks, reporting, integrations |
| Hyper CRM | $97/mo | Everything in Growth plus calling/SMS, website visitors in CRM, Salesflows, advanced reporting |
Priority AI and Follow-up AI listed as “coming soon” as of March 2026.
Inbox Placement Plans
| Plan | Monthly Cost (Annual) | Key Features |
| Growth Inbox Placement | $47/mo | Unlimited one-time tests, domain/IP monitoring, SPF/DMARC/DKIM, blacklist checks |
| Hypergrowth Inbox Placement | $97/mo | Everything in Growth plus unlimited recurring tests, advanced triggers and actions |
Website Visitors Plans
| Plan | Monthly Cost (Annual) | Credits | Key Features |
| Hyper Visitors | $97/mo | 500 | Company resolutions, phone resolutions, auto-add to campaigns |
| Lightspeed Visitors | $397/mo | 5,000 | Same features as Hyper |
| Enterprise | Custom | Custom | Contact support |
What It Actually Costs: The Stacked Math
Here’s what real users actually pay depending on their use case:
| Use Case | Modules | Monthly Cost (Annual) |
| Just outreach + warm-up | Email Outreach Growth | $47/mo |
| Outreach + leads | Outreach Growth + Credits Growth | $89/mo |
| Outreach + leads + CRM | Outreach Growth + Credits Growth + Growth CRM | $136/mo |
| Agency full stack | Hyper Growth + Credits Growth + Growth CRM + Growth Inbox Placement | $233/mo |
| Everything on mid tiers | Hyper Growth + Supersonic Credits + Hyper CRM + Hypergrowth Placement + Hyper Visitors | $475/mo |
This isn’t a criticism of the modular model. You genuinely only pay for what you use, and most users start with just outreach. But the “$37/month” pricing that appears in pre-2026 blog posts is outdated. Growth Email Outreach is now $47/mo.
The modular structure means most real users spend $90 to $230+ once they add leads or CRM. Know this before you budget.
Last verified: March 2026.
Instantly.ai Pros and Cons
Pros
- Fast, clean setup: One of the easiest cold email tools to get running. No technical experience required.
- Unlimited email account connections: All paid plans. No per-inbox pricing friction as you scale.
- Multi-inbox campaign splitting: Spread high-volume outreach across dozens of inboxes without hitting individual account send limits.
- Built-in warm-up runs automatically: No separate tool setup required for most standard use cases.
- All-in-one potential: Outreach, leads, CRM, inbox placement testing, and website visitor identification under one dashboard.
- Genuinely useful AI features: AI sequence generator, AI reply agent, and Copilot analytics assistant.
- Free trial with no credit card: 250 contacts included to test the core features.
- Website visitor identification: A unique capability. No other cold email platform includes this natively at this price point.
Cons
- Modular pricing adds up fast: Full stack costs $180 to $475/month on annual billing. Most real users spend significantly more than the entry price.
- Warm-up uses a seed network, not peer-to-peer: Warm-up scores inside the platform don’t reflect actual inbox placement performance.
- No real-time deliverability diagnostics: When things go wrong, there are no alerts and no tooling to identify why.
- DFY setup creates domain ownership risk: Documented across Trustpilot and Reddit. Understand the terms before using the service.
- Credits system migration (2025) caused billing confusion: Glitches flagged on Trustpilot as recently as early 2026.
- CRM is lightweight: Not a substitute for HubSpot or Pipedrive if you need real pipeline depth.
- Support quality is inconsistent at scale: Fast for simple issues. Slower and sometimes unresponsive for complex multi-account problems.
- Lead database accuracy issues: Elevated bounce rates from raw exports without waterfall enrichment are well-documented.
Who Should Use Instantly.ai (And Who Shouldn’t)
Instantly Is a Good Fit If…
- You’re an agency or solo operator running high-volume cold email (10,000 to 100,000+ emails per month) and need multi-inbox management without per-inbox pricing
- You want a modular all-in-one stack and don’t mind paying separately for each module. If you’d otherwise pay for Apollo (leads), Smartlead (outreach), and a CRM separately, Instantly’s bundled cost is competitive.
- You’re just starting with cold email and want warm-up included without configuring a separate tool. The built-in warm-up handles standard use cases well.
- You want to capture website visitors and auto-add them to outreach sequences. The Website Visitors module is genuinely unique in the cold email space.
- Your budget is $47 to $140/month and you just need outreach plus leads. The Growth Email Outreach plus Credits Growth combination covers the core use case for most small teams.
Instantly May Not Be the Right Fit If…
- You need deep deliverability visibility and control. The warm-up black box is a real limitation if your domains are critical business assets and you can’t afford unexplained deliverability drops.
- You’re considering the DFY setup service and planning to eventually migrate. Understand the domain ownership terms before you commit. Multiple users flagged this as a problem when trying to leave.
- You need enterprise CRM functionality. If you’re already on HubSpot or Salesforce, Instantly’s CRM adds monthly cost without replacing your existing stack.
- You’re running mostly Outlook-heavy outreach. The deliverability inconsistency with Outlook accounts is documented enough to be worth testing before committing to annual billing.
- You’re already using a dedicated warm-up tool and happy with it. In that case, use Instantly for what it’s great at (outreach and multi-inbox management) and keep your warm-up separate.
FAQs About Instantly.ai
Is Instantly.ai worth it?
Yes, for high-volume cold email outreach. If you’re an agency or SDR team sending 50,000+ emails per month and need multi-inbox management, Instantly delivers strong value.
The limitations show up if you need deep deliverability control or a full-featured CRM.
The modular pricing also means real costs are higher than the entry price suggests.
How much does Instantly.ai cost?
Email Outreach starts at $47/month on the annual plan. Add Lead Finder and you’re at $89/month.
Add CRM and it’s $136/month. An agency running the full stack pays $233+ per month.
Does Instantly.ai have a free plan?
No free plan. Instantly offers a 14-day free trial with 250 uploaded contacts and no credit card required.
This gives you enough access to test the campaign builder, warm-up, and core outreach features before committing to a paid plan.
Is Instantly.ai good for email deliverability?
The built-in warm-up covers most standard use cases. It uses a private seed network of 4.2M+ accounts, not peer-to-peer warm-up.
When your technical setup is clean and you follow the 20 to 30 day warm-up timeline, it works well.
When deliverability degrades, the platform offers no diagnostic tooling. You won’t know why something went wrong.
What’s the difference between Instantly’s warm-up and a dedicated warm-up tool?
Instantly uses a seed network model. Its own pool of accounts exchanges emails with your inbox to build engagement signals.
Dedicated tools like TrulyInbox use peer-to-peer warm-up between real, independent inboxes. This generates more authentic engagement signals.
The two approaches aren’t mutually exclusive. You can run Instantly for outreach and a dedicated warm-up tool for deliverability monitoring simultaneously.
Is Instantly.ai legit?
Yes. It’s a real product with a 4.8 out of 5 rating on G2 from 3,400+ verified reviews.
The lower Trustpilot score (3.8 out of 5) reflects specific complaints about DFY domain ownership, credits billing changes in 2025, and support quality at scale.
Not a scam. A legitimate tool with real, specific trade-offs worth understanding.
How do Instantly credits work?
Credits are the currency for the Lead Finder module. They’re separate from the Email Outreach subscription. One credit equals one contact accessed from the database.
Plans start at $9/month for 150 credits (Nano) up to $177.30/month for 10,000 to 200,000 credits (Hyper) on annual billing. Verify whether credits roll over at time of purchase.
